Bardonia, NY vs Tarrytown, NY
There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Bardonia is 24.2% cheaper than Tarrytown. With a cost index of 117 vs 155,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Bardonia to Tarrytown should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.
On the housing front, median rent in Bardonia is $943/month compared to $2,065/month in Tarrytown — a 54%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Bardonia is more affordable at $599,000 median vs $639,700.
Median household income in Bardonia is $123,750 compared to $109,732 in Tarrytown (+12.8%). Bardonia off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of Bardonia spend roughly 9.1% of their income on rent, less than the 22.6% in Tarrytown.
